NRF2 antibody LS-C118534 is an unconjugated rabbit polyclonal antibody to NRF2 (NFE2L2) (C-Terminus) from human. It is reactive with human, mouse and rat. Validated for IF, IHC, Peptide-ELISA and WB. Cited in 1 publication.
